#0e6312 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#0e6312 is composed of 5.5% red, 38.8% green and 7.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 85.9% cyan, 0% magenta, 81.8% yellow and 61.2% black. It has a hue angle of 122.8 degrees, a saturation of 75.2% and a lightness of 22.2%. #0e6312 color hex could be obtained by blending #1cc624 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#006600.

Shades and Tints of #0e6312
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020d02 is the darkest color, while #fbfefb is the lightest one.

Tones of #0e6312
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#353c35 is the less saturated color, while #017006 is the most saturated one.
